Liliana Bairrão
Crew
The Last Page
Executive Producer
On The Edge
Sound Editor, Sound
How Much Does A Body Weigh?
Focus Puller
9 to 5
Director of Photography
To God’s Will
Director of Photography
Big River, Big Fish
Production Assistant